This is a stylish, atmospheric, 'arty" film. I found it watchable. I can see why many gave it a low rating as much of what happens is unexplained and the fight scenes are diabolical (so bad that I found them funny), but the characters are interesting the scenes are beautifully shot and I wanted to see how it ended. Don't be put off by the low ratings.
This movie is visually stunning and artfully shot. That being said, the plot is rushed, weak, and many things are left unexplained. People in this movie fight like you punch in your dreams. There are phallic objects entering people's throats. There are unexplained creepy hotel staff and unnecessarily mixed costumes from the Victorian era, the 40's, and awful 90's club wear. If you watch the film without any sound or captions, it's actually a lot less confusing.
I only finished watching this movie so it wouldn't haunt my Continue Watching list for eternity.

As a few people have said here, it is technically beautiful, but there is no coherent plot/storyline. And even if the English language title was correctly translated (Black Fire) it still wouldn't be any indication of what is going on. The fight scenes are not done properly, there are only a few of them, so that didn't affect the movie. While the one woman was nice eye candy, and probably the man as well, the sex scenes were unnecessary and added (nor subtracted) from the apparently non-existent plot.
I don't want any spoilers here, so I won't try to explain what is going on. The acting isn't that good, although some of the eye contact is actually better than the acting.
And because this movie makes no sense it seems to be a part of some series, if not then this movie needs a prequel to explain what is going on.
The things I did like about this movie were the 'hero' rode a motorcycle, so glad it wasn't some muscle car from the 60s. And best was the way it was shot and lit, the sound wasn't bad either.
This might be interesting to film students, but if you are looking for entertainment, even at the B movie level, you really won't find it here.
